"We Know, We Can, We Will"
Religious Education and Philosophy is broadly Christian, but encompasses all major faiths; RE themes include respect, self-esteem, appreciation and wonder; the curriculum aims to promote spiritual, moral, social, and cultural development.
The Principal, Dougal Scott, emphasizes the motto We Know, We Can, We Will, and speaks to the school’s commitment to achievement, progression and a strong ethos. He highlights the family-like relationships among staff, students and parents and the aim for outstanding progress and leadership.

To apply for a place, name Harris Invictus Academy Croydon on the London Borough of Croydon’s online application form. If you don’t live in Croydon, you can still apply; name the Academy on the application form for the borough in which you live. For further information, see the admissions page.
